Senior Data Scientist, Research and Development

Cargill is committed to providing food and agricultural solutions to nourish the world in a safe, responsible, and sustainable way. As a Senior Data Scientist in Research and Development, you will work collaboratively in multidisciplinary teams to develop complex proofs of concept and scalable solutions that enhance food manufacturing processes.

Responsibilities

Work on multidisciplinary teams of data engineers, software engineers, data scientists and business subject matter experts to deliver complex projects on time and within budgets
Translate ambiguous and complex business problems into project charters clearly identifying technical risks and project scope
Take ownership for the entire data science workflow that includes a well-defined, complex project scope, exploratory data analysis, model development, deployment and monitoring
Continuously seek out best practices and develop skills
Create scalable structures to accelerate deployment to multiple facilities
Independently handle complex issues with minimal supervision, while escalating only the most complex issues to appropriate staff
Other duties as assigned

Qualification

Python programmingComputer vision modelsMLOps practicesDockerAWSData ScienceMathematicsContinuous integrationSoft skills

Required

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related field; or equivalent practical experience
Minimum of 4 years of relevant professional experience, OR 3 years experience with a Master's degree, OR 2 years experience with a Ph.D. in a related discipline
Proficiency in Python programming
Hands-on experience developing computer vision models for image classification, object detection, and segmentation
Experience with computer vision tools, both traditional and deep learning, such as OpenCV, PyTorch, etc including transfer learning and fine-tuning deep learning models
Experience deploying ML models using a containerized deployment framework (Docker, Podman, etc)
Proven ability to develop proofs of concept and scale them into full production solutions
Demonstrated ability to present complex concepts to non-technical audiences

Preferred

Master's degree or PhD in data science, computer science, math, engineering or related field
Solid understanding of Computer Vision fundamentals
Knowledge of MLOps practices for productionizing vision models
Experience scaling a production solution to multiple sites
Experience working with continuous integration and delivery (CI/CD) pipelines
Experience working with AWS
Experience in manufacturing, supply chain, or agriculture
